In the story of the Garden Party the blue was veiled with a haze of light gold why do you think the author described the sky this way?

The description of the sky as "blue veiled with a haze of light gold" creates a sense of beauty and tranquility. It suggests a serene atmosphere, enhancing the setting of the garden party. The use of such vivid imagery helps to set the tone for the events that unfold in the story.
